Evaluating the performance efficiency of qualified open channels
Evaluating the performance efficiency of qualified open channels before and after the implementation of improved maintenance programs.
Providing the developed and appropriate maintenance method
Providing the developed and appropriate maintenance method (manual mechanical - biological) for the qualified open channels according to the type of qualification and the nature of each channel, and following up on its application and ensuring that the maintenance objectives are achieved.
Submitting technical proposals for the production of fuel pellets from the water hyacinth plant
Submitting technical proposals for the production of fuel pellets from the water hyacinth plant as a new source of energy to maximize the benefit from the aquatic weeds.
Providing technologies to maximize the investment benefit
Providing technologies to maximize the investment benefit from water hyacinth and aquatic weeds removed from waterways in the production of biogas and safe organic fertilizer.
Automatic presentation Smart programs for managing aquatic weeds
Automatic presentation Smart programs for managing aquatic weeds, especially water hyacinth, in the Nile River, the Rosetta branch, open channels, and lakes. Selected to improve its performance efficiency and conserve water from loss.
Estimating the areas and percentages of infestation of aquatic weeds
Estimating the areas and percentages of infestation of aquatic weeds in selected Egyptian lakes and in Lakes Kyoga, Albert, and Victoria in Uganda.
Estimating the areas and percentages of water hyacinth infestation and other species
Estimating the areas and percentages of water hyacinth infestation and other species in the Nile River, the Rosetta branch and selected channels are periodically monitored to help identify aquatic weed problems early and follow up on the implementation of appropriate maintenance programs, which reduces the costs of periodic weed maintenance and increases the efficiency of open channels.
